I'm happy to announce the 1.0 release of WordReport. This library lets 
your LiveCode stacks crank out MS Word and OpenOffice reports of any 
kind: business documents, contractor invoices, real-estate flyers, mail 
merge, product catalogs, software data reports, educational worksheets, 
band concert posters, customer service letters, or whatever else you 
dream up. (In fact, the demo stack includes sample code and templates 
for three of those scenarios.)

You create a formatted template with data insertion tags, save it, and 
then insert your data from within LiveCode to create reports. WordReport 
is self-contained and doesn't need any word processing software to 
create reports, but you'll need MS Word or OpenOffice to create the 
templates. The demo stack will get you off to a quick start exploring 
capabilities, and a friendly User Guide explains everything.

The library handles images as well as text and has other advanced 
features such as loops and optional context marking. It handles Unicode 
and as a bonus, in addition to the unlimited formatting in your 
template, you can include basic styles within your export data for extra 
emphasis on the fly. It does headers and footers too. And tables. (And 
number formatting with commas if you need it.) Everything you need to 
make customers and clients happy with great-looking reports, while 
improving your own back office workflow too.
